How New Mexico is Driving Clean Energy Savings and Equity

New Mexico’s community solar program is accelerating clean energy growth and equity to help reach the state's goal of 50% renewable energy by 2030. Our latest blog explores this expanding initiative — including its 30% low-income carve-out — and how Standard Solar is leading the charge. With more than 65 MW of projects in New Mexico, highlighted by our new 48.4 MW portfolio, we are proud to strengthen the region’s clean-energy supply.

Powering Local Resilience: The Knox Solar + Storage Project

Energy storage has evolved from a simple backup power solution into a core driver of solar project economics and grid resilience. Putting this into practice, we partnered with the Massachusetts Acton Water District to develop two robust solar plus storage systems: the Knox 1.5 MW solar and 2 MWh storage project, and the Lawsbrook 4.7 MW solar and 4 MWh storage system.
